Community Development Compliance Specialist ensures the organization's adherence with Community Reinvestment Act (CRA) banking laws. Reviews and analyzes lending activity data as well as other activities and policies of the organization to ensure compliance with CRA policies. Being a Community Development Compliance Specialist coordinates the preparation of required government, regulatory, and other compliance documents for all community development activities. Advises management and coordinates with legal staff on potential impact of actions. Additionally, Community Development Compliance Specialist develops and recommends guidelines and standards to assist with compliance. Has current and extensive knowledge of all CRA regulations and policies.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Community Development Compliance Specialist gains ex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. To be a Community Development Compliance Specialist typically requires 2 to 4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Save Red Rock – a nonprofit organization committed to preserving and protecting the safety, sustainability and accessibility of Red Rock Canyon NCA – is looking for a part-time Social Media and Marketing Manager to work in tandem with the Interim Executive Director and governing Board. The Marketing Manager will be in charge of social, digital ad and email content creation, distribution and analysis plus reporting. He/She/They will be expected to draft and distribute all social, advertising and e-blast content, attend weekly board meetings, meet with elected officials, and attend special events. We are a small but hard-working team that combines part-time staff with a volunteer board and advisory team, with the need to work independently and report back to the group. At times, the Marketing Manager may be called upon to pitch in on event planning or attendance, public-facing roles such as making speeches at public meetings, and more. Though not a requirement, the ideal candidate will have a passion for recreation of any/all kinds at Red Rock Canyon and be a frequent visitor.
